When Platinum Rusts is a biopunk dystopian fantasy about the fragile beginnings of a future we never meant to enter. In the ruins of a failed colonisation project, Eternum, Doctor Selest Dvali leads a desperate to engineer a new kind of human. Not from ambition, but from fear, duty, and love. With only scraps of forgotten technology and a few fractured allies, Selest attempts to build loaders—genetically and technologically enhanced beings, strong enough to survive civilisation’s end. But the deeper she delves, the more the lines blur. Ethics erode. Mistakes multiply. And every failure leaves a permanent scar. Set fifty years before the Who is Vist series, this novel stands alone to uncover the buried legacy and the secret origin of Vist.
Anka B. Troitsky is an award-winning author and introvert passionate about sci-fi and games.
Originally from Kazakhstan, she relocated to the UK in 1993, where she previously worked as a science teacher and interpreter in Essex.
Anka's profound connection with books has been instrumental in her professional and personal growth, considering some of her favourite authors as her best friends and teachers.
Specialising in science fiction and satirical fantasy, she believes these genres offer a unique blend of imagination and philosophical exploration. Through her storytelling, Anka shares her fascination and concerns with readers who share similar interests.
Her books, while often exploring past and future themes, ultimately are about the present, human choices and decisions.
